- In 1997 the London Classical Players was absorbed into the
OAE and Sir Roger Norrington joined the roster of conductors. The OAE is an
Associate of London's Royal Festival Hall.
- "The OAE uses the type of instruments which were current when the works
performed were written. The orchestra for which Handel composed played at a pitch of
approximately A=415 (around a half-step lower than today's accepted pitch of A=440-446),
had stringed instruments with low-tension gut strings and convex bows (light and supple
for clear phrasing) and wind instruments of a rounder and softer timbre than their
present-day equivalents. In addition, the orchestras of the day commonly included the
continuo instruments harpsichord and archlute, or theorbe (already archaic in Handel's
time, but which he continued to employ in his own performances).
"Mozart's instrumentalists, however, had slightly more developed instruments. The
wind instruments had more keys, which permitted greater facility in playing, and the
timbre was changed along the way, allowing greater projection. The pitch was higher at
A=430, which gave a brighter sound to the strings. Again, however this sound was quite
distinct from that of modern counterparts." (excerpt from CD booklet of Endless
Pleasure - Handel & Mozart Arias with Ruth Ann Swenson, soprano)

- The ensemble is named after the Dutch composer and statesman Unico Wilhelm van Wassenaer
(1692-1766). Only recently it has become clear that several of the compositions used by I.
Stravinsky for his Pulcinella which were believed to be by Pergolesi, are actually
composed by Van Wassenaer.
- The director, Makoto Akatsu, has gathered players that have studied historical
performance practice at The Royal Conservatorium in The Hague, and have been particularly
influenced by the style of Sigiswald Kuijken. This common musical background gives the
group a strong unified sense of style.
- Ensemble's artistic misson: The orchestra is a reconstruction of an 18th-century string
ensemble, playing on copies of instruments and recreating music that would have been
played during his time. Exploring baroque repertoire has been the groups aim, with
particular interest in the Concerti Armonici of Van Wassenaer.
- Surprisingly the group has found that van Wassenaer's instrumentation of two violoncelli
in his Concerti Armonici is often suffcient without adding a double bass. This can give
the group its characteristic rich and yet light bass sound.
